These institutions are regulated by the Reserve Bank Of … Witryna7 kwi 2024 · The Rural Credit system in India is separated into two parts: an unstructured or informal system of lenders, merchants, and input suppliers, and a formal, organized system made up of cooperatives, regional rural banks, the banking sector, and nonbanking financial enterprises. Witryna25 lip 2024 · Why formal sources are better than informal sources? Formal sources of credit are always preferred over informal sources because: A high rate of interest: The informal sources like moneylenders will charge any rate of interest which will lead to huge cost the borrowers to repay and lenders can easily exploit the borrowers.
